REMOVE NON-ESSENTIAL SCHOOL ACTIVITIES and TASKS TO MAKE AUGUST-MAY SCHOOL YEAR WORK – Press Release from ACT Party-List

I laud the Department of Education for deciding to open the school year in August, as I suggested a month ago. Now, I present some suggestions on how to make the August to May school year work effectively for all stakeholders – school administrators, teachers, students, and parents.

·      Unload the classroom teachers of all the non-teaching administrative, health-related, and social welfare responsibilities. They are teachers. They are not nurses, social workers, nor administrative staff.

·      Tinatambakan ang teachers ng mga trabahong hindi pang-teacher. Trabaho ng teacher ang mag-lecture, maghanda sa pamamagitan ng paggawa ng lesson plan, at i-evaluate ang kanyang trabaho sa pamamagitan ng pagsusumite ng monitoring and evaluation reports.

·      Paigsiin ang sembreak. Alisin lahat ng mga non-academic extra-curricular events sa activities calendar. Marami iyan. Nababawasan ang contact time sa mga estudyante dahil sa maraming aktibidad na dagdag-trabaho sa mga guro.

·      Devote August to March to classroom contact time activities. Cut down on extra-curricular activities like commemorations and observances, so that contact time in classrooms is maximized.

·      Relocate toward the end of the school calendar, in April and May, all the teachers’ seminars, the student government elections and co-curricular activities like the science fairs, quiz bees, DepEd-Metrobank Math Challenge, National Festival of Talents, the National Schools Press Conference, and the sports competitions.

·  Principals and their teachers should spend much less time attending meetings called by the superintendents, supervisors, and regional offices. All essential meetings should not interfere with classroom sessions.

·      Teachers should also not be doing income-generation activities during school hours like selling products or participating in SEC-flagged investment scams.

If doing all that is not enough, DepEd can also ask Malacanang and Congress to cancel or modify all the special non-working national holidays and local holidays from August this year to May next year. (END)
